在React中,可以通过编程方式触发模糊、聚焦、单击和选择事件。下面是一种实现方式:
blur()
方法来模拟模糊事件的触发,例如:const inputElement = document.getElementById('inputField');
inputElement.blur();
focus()
方法来模拟聚焦事件的触发,例如:const inputElement = document.getElementById('inputField');
inputElement.focus();
click()
方法来模拟单击事件的触发,例如:const inputElement = document.getElementById('inputField');
inputElement.click();
select()
方法来模拟选择事件的触发,例如:const inputElement = document.getElementById('inputField');
inputElement.select();
以上代码示例假设输入字段的id为inputField
,你可以根据实际情况修改代码中的选择器。
这些事件的触发可以用于模拟用户与输入字段的交互,例如在特定条件下自动触发模糊、聚焦、单击和选择事件。这在自动化测试、表单验证等场景中非常有用。
腾讯云提供了丰富的云计算产品,其中与前端开发相关的产品包括云服务器(CVM)、云函数(SCF)、云存储(COS)等。你可以根据具体需求选择适合的产品进行开发和部署。
更多关于腾讯云产品的信息,你可以访问腾讯云官方网站:腾讯云。
领取专属 10元无门槛券
手把手带您无忧上云